Commits

Author Commit Message Labels Comments Date
Kumar McMillan
merge
Kumar McMillan
bumped fudge.js __version__ to 0.9.2 to keep up with the python lib (note that it does *not* implement the full 0.9.2 interface)
Kumar McMillan
for doc purposes show that patch_object is available as a top-level import
Kumar McMillan
fixed (re-fixed?) type error when running javascript tests for fudge.js relating to undefined nosejs (I swear I already fixed this)
Kumar McMillan
Added one more threading lock while saving the original object value
Kumar McMillan
Better API docs (split patcher stuff into fudge.patcher)
Kumar McMillan
better doctest for returns_fake()
Kumar McMillan
returns_fake() now uses the name of the call it was attached to
Kumar McMillan
Added additional test for ordered expectations when using returns_fake()
Kumar McMillan
moved registry tests to a separate test file
Kumar McMillan
added threading locks when patching objects (it is still not thread safe)
Kumar McMillan
fixed python 2.4 compatibility by making a custom context manager (could not yield in try/finally like last implementation)
Kumar McMillan
clearing expectations is hidden in doctest when appropriate
Kumar McMillan
too many calls now raises an exception with remember_order()
Kumar McMillan
out of order assertions are now made early and often
Kumar McMillan
Fixed from fudge import *
Kumar McMillan
fixed version pattern in docs conf
Kumar McMillan
Fixed bug where returns() did not work if called after calls()
Kumar McMillan
simplified version regex in setup.py
Kumar McMillan
updated version regex in setup.py
Kumar McMillan
Changed next_call(after=) to next_call(for_method=) since that makes more sense
Kumar McMillan
Minor doc changes
Kumar McMillan
Added usage docs for remember_order()
Kumar McMillan
Renamed "Fudge Examples" section to "Using Fudge" in docs
Kumar McMillan
* Added next_call(after="other_call")
Kumar McMillan
Added test for not enough calls error (when ordered)
Kumar McMillan
Added API docs for remember_order()
Kumar McMillan
tested that clear_calls() and verify() should reset call orders
Kumar McMillan
renamed old test failure messages that still were using start/stop
Kumar McMillan
renamed some straggler registry tests still using start/stop
  1. Prev
  2. Next